Understanding the Regulatory and Economic Context
New Zealand’s gambling regulatory framework is primarily governed by the “Gambling Act 2003,” which restricts online gambling to a tightly controlled environment, primarily focusing on sports betting and pokies via land-based venues. However, this regulatory stance has become increasingly complex as international online casinos attract more Kiwi players seeking varied entertainment options.
According to New Zealand’s Ministry of Business, Innovation and Employment, online gambling accounts for approximately 20-25% of the total gambling turnover, signaling a significant shift towards digital platforms. This trend underscores the importance for both operators and consumers to develop a nuanced understanding of legal boundaries, responsible gambling measures, and available incentives.
Market Dynamics: Competition, Innovation, and Consumer Preferences
The competitive environment in New Zealand’s online casino industry is complex, rooted in the global reach of top-tier operators and the emergence of local brands seeking differentiation. Key factors influencing consumer choice include game variety, payout rates, and promotional offers. The availability of attractive bonuses, especially for new players, has become a critical driver of customer acquisition and retention.
For gamblers, the allure of seamless user experiences and innovative features—such as live dealer games and mobile-optimized platforms—are vital. Industry data suggests that approximately 65% of online gambling activity now occurs on smartphones, emphasizing the importance of responsive design and personalized bonuses.
